Make Sense of Your Benefits with a Universal Credit Calculator
A Universal Credit Calculator is an online financial estimation tool that helps individuals and families understand how much support they may receive from the Universal Credit system in the United Kingdom. Universal Credit is a welfare program designed to replace several older benefits with a single monthly payment. It is intended to support people who are unemployed, on low income, caring for children, living with disabilities, or struggling with housing costs. Because the system is based on multiple rules and personal circumstances, calculating entitlement manually can be difficult. A Universal Credit Calculator simplifies this process by providing an estimated payment based on user input.

The calculator typically works through a step-by-step process where users enter key details about their financial situation. This may include monthly income, type of employment, household size, savings, rent or housing costs, childcare expenses, and any health conditions affecting work ability. Once this information is provided, the calculator processes the data and produces an estimated Universal Credit payment. Although it does not replace official government assessments, it offers a useful indication of what a claimant might expect.

People with variable income often rely heavily on these calculators. In today’s economy, many individuals work freelance jobs, part-time positions, or temporary contracts where income changes from month to month. Since Universal Credit payments adjust based on earnings, it can be difficult to predict monthly support. A calculator allows users to test different income scenarios and see how changes affect their entitlement. This helps them make informed decisions about work opportunities and budgeting.
